Wie kann man die Verrohrung richtig umkehren?

340
Mathias Maes

Ich versuche, das Pfeifen rückgängig zu machen. Genauer gesagt versuche ich, diese Aussage umzukehren:

echo 'benutzer: passwd' | sudo chpasswd

Ich würde gerne den "sudo chpasswd" im Voraus erhalten. Ich habe beides versucht:

sudo chpasswd <echo 'Benutzer: Passwd'

Und:

sudo chpasswd <(echo 'Benutzer: Passwd')

Beide funktionieren nicht und vor allem der letzte, den ich nicht verstehe.

Kann ich machen was ich will? Wenn das so ist, wie?

-1

1 Antwort auf die Frage

1
mtak

Folgendes funktioniert auf Ubuntu 17.10 mit bash 4.4.12:

sudo chpasswd < <( echo 'mtak:password' )